Three killed over piece of land

DADU, Dec 28: Three people were shot dead in an armed clash over a piece of land in Mehar on Tuesday.

SHO Mehar Allah Dino Panhwar told journalists that some people from Chandio clan were coming to Mehar town on motorcycles when a group of people belonging to Khosos attacked them.

In the gunbattle two Chandios and one Khoso died. They had been identified as Asghar Ali, Arz Mohammad and Allah Dino.

Mehar police have registered a double murder case

against Ghulam Rasool, Ali Haider, Yasin, Sardar, Mehar, Chakar and Sikandar, all Khoso by caste. No FIR for murder of Asghar Ali Khoso could be registered.
